Coinbase Integrates Solana DEX: How 100M Users Gaining Direct Access Redefines Crypto Trading
The traditional wall between centralized exchanges (CEXs) and decentralized finance (DeFi) just developed a massive gateway. At the ongoing Solana Breakpoint 2025 conference in Abu Dhabi, Coinbase announced the launch of DEX trading for Solana-based assets, a strategic expansion that follows its earlier rollout for the Base network. This integration means that, for the first time, over 100 million Coinbase users can seamlessly trade "millions of tokens" launched daily on Solana—without those tokens needing an official Coinbase listing.
The announcement, made by Coinbase protocol specialist Andrew Allen and confirmed by Solana's official X account, represents more than a simple feature addition. It is a strategic maneuver that positions Coinbase at the forefront of the CEX-DeFi convergence, potentially reshaping how mainstream users interact with decentralized markets while maintaining the regulatory-compliant interface they trust.

How It Works: The Technical Bridge Between CEX and DEX
Coinbase's integration operates as a sophisticated middleware layer that translates user actions on its familiar interface into transactions on Solana's decentralized exchanges like Jupiter, Orca, and Raydium.
| Component | Function | User Experience Impact |
|---|---|---|
| User Interface | Familiar Coinbase trading interface | No learning curve for existing users |
| Routing Engine | Finds optimal liquidity across Solana DEXs | Best execution prices automatically |
| Wallet Integration | Manages transaction signing and security | Maintains Coinbase-level security standards |
| Settlement Layer | Executes on Solana blockchain | Near-instant confirmation (<1 sec) |
This architecture means users can trade newly launched Solana meme coins, DeFi tokens, or NFTs through their existing Coinbase accounts minutes after they appear on decentralized exchanges. The technical implementation uses Coinbase's existing MPC (Multi-Party Computation) wallet technology to secure assets while executing trades directly on-chain.
Market Note: "By routing trades through DEXs rather than listing tokens directly, Coinbase may navigate regulatory complexities around securities classification more effectively. The exchange provides access but doesn't technically 'list' or endorse the tokens—maintaining a regulatory-compliant position while expanding access."
Market Impact of Coinbase Integrating Solana DEX Trading: Liquidity, Competition, and Ecosystem Effects
The integration creates immediate and profound effects across multiple dimensions of the crypto market:
1. Liquidity Consolidation: Solana DEXs gain immediate access to $100+ billion in potential buying power from Coinbase's user base. This could significantly deepen liquidity for Solana-based assets, reducing slippage and improving market efficiency across the ecosystem.
2. Competitive Pressure: Other centralized exchanges now face pressure to offer similar DEX integrations or risk losing users to Coinbase's expanded offering. This announcement comes as competitors like Binance face regulatory challenges and Kraken focuses on its own Layer 2 development.
3. Solana Ecosystem Growth: With easier access for mainstream users, Solana-based projects may see accelerated adoption. Developers gain a clear path to reach Coinbase's massive user base without navigating traditional listing processes that can take months and require significant legal overhead.

FAQ: Understanding Coinbase's Solana DEX Integration
What exactly did Coinbase announce for Solana?
Coinbase announced the integration of direct DEX (decentralized exchange) trading for Solana-based assets, allowing its 100+ million users to trade millions of Solana tokens directly through their Coinbase accounts without those tokens needing official Coinbase listings.
How is this different from regular Coinbase trading?
Instead of trading on Coinbase's internal order books, users' trades are routed through Solana DEXs like Jupiter and Orca. This provides access to thousands of tokens not officially listed on Coinbase, with execution happening directly on the Solana blockchain.
Why is this announcement strategically important?
It represents a major step in CEX-DeFi convergence, gives Coinbase a potential regulatory advantage (providing access without technically "listing" tokens), pressures competitors to offer similar features, and could significantly increase liquidity across the Solana ecosystem.
